Instructions

Step 1

Preheat the oven to 350ËšF. Lightly grease a square baking dish with cooking spray and set aside.

Step 2

Boil pasta shells in a large pot of salted water. Once ready, drain and set aside.

Step 3

Meanwhile, prepare the filling in a large bowl. Add shredded turkey, diced onion, celery, garlic, local shredded cheddar cheese and stuffing. Add salt and pepper to taste.

Step 4

Prepare your casserole dish with gravy on the bottom. Begin filling pasta shells with filling mixture. Place on top of gravy. Add stuffing pieces, local cheddar cheese and bake for 25-30 minutes. Once ready, garnish with parsley and serve.
